Yea, brother, let me have joy of thee in the Lord: refresh my bowels in the Lord.
Let me
Bible References
Let me
2 Corinthians 2:2
For if I grieve you, who also is it that gladdens me, if not he that is grieved through me?
2 Corinthians 7:4
Great is my boldness towards you, great my exulting in respect of you; I am filled with encouragement; I overabound in joy under all our affliction.
Philippians 2:2
fulfil my joy, that ye may think the same thing, having the same love, joined in soul, thinking one thing;
Philippians 4:1
So that, my brethren, beloved and longed for, my joy and crown, thus stand fast in the Lord, beloved.
1 Thessalonians 2:19
For what is our hope, or joy, or crown of boasting? are not ye also before our Lord Jesus at his coming?
1 Thessalonians 3:7
for this reason we have been comforted in you, brethren, in all our distress and tribulation, through your faith,
Hebrews 13:17
Obey your leaders, and be submissive; for they watch over your souls as those that shall give account; that they may do this with joy, and not groaning, for this would be unprofitable for you.
3 John 1:4
I have no greater joy than these things that I hear of my children walking in the truth.
Refresh
Philemon 1:7
For we have great thankfulness and encouragement through thy love, because the bowels of the saints are refreshed by thee, brother.
Philippians 1:8
For God is my witness how I long after you all in the bowels of Christ Jesus.
Philippians 2:1
If then there be any comfort in Christ, if any consolation of love, if any fellowship of the Spirit, if any bowels and compassions,
1 John 3:17
But whoso may have the world's substance, and see his brother having need, and shut up his bowels from him, how abides the love of God in him?
